The match concluded with Estudiantes edging past Dep. Riestra with a score of 1-0, marking an important win for the Pincha in Round 4 of the Apertura. The decisive moment came in the 74th minute when Guido Carrillo found the net with a powerful header from a cross by Brian Aguirre.
Guido Carrillo was the standout player, not only scoring the lone goal but also attempting four shots throughout the match, showcasing his offensive prowess. Goalkeeper Fernando Muslera also played a crucial role for Estudiantes, making three key saves to maintain the clean sheet against Dep. Riestra.
In this encounter, head coach Eduardo Domínguez employed a 4-5-1 tactical formation, featuring Muslera in goal, with Eric Meza, Leandro González Pirez, Tomás Palacios, and Gastón Benedetti as the defensive line. The midfield consisted of José Sosa, Lucas Piovi, Fabricio Pérez, Cristian Medina, and Joaquín Tobio Burgos, while Carrillo led the attack.
Meanwhile, Gustavo Benítez’s team opted for a 5-3-2 formation, with Ignacio Arce guarding the net. The defense was comprised of Pedro Ramírez, Nicolás Sansotre, Cristian Paz, Miguel Ángel Barbieri, and Rodrigo Gallo. In midfield, Jonatan Goitía, Pablo Monje, and Antony Alonso controlled play, with Jonathan Herrera and Nicolás Benegas up front.
The referee overseeing the match was Facundo Tello Figueroa, ensuring that the game flowed smoothly.
Looking ahead, Estudiantes will face Gimnasia away in the upcoming match, a significant rivalry clash in the classic Platense. On the other hand, Dep. Riestra will take on Newell’s at home.
